This my 25th annual pilgrimage to Outer Banks of North Kackalackly was shorter than I would have liked. And oddly it is same every year, even when I spent a week down fishing and cleansing my soul. Some how the salty surf seems to remove the impending doom of the Holidays and transform me into a more understanding patient soul.
Ida did a lot of damage to my land between the sea. My OBX is missing allot of beach. My pics will tell the story. BTW all I caught was doggies.. But it really does not matter.. This is the best place on earth.. A SHARP CONTRAST BETWEEN RUGGED AND EASY.. PS my new best friend is named George. 25 years,,,,,OK the first time down I got into 17lb bluefish for two whole days.. I honestly thought it was always like this..idiot.. I went 7years with only a few Chinese flounder so I know patience.. Capt Mike
